Isaac Ensel, left, and Drew and Gideon Walden, all of Bath, ride in the back of a truck during the Memorial Day Parade in Bath. The annual parade was almost scuttled after the local American Legion post admitted running an illegal gambling operation and ran out of cash, but it took place after an anonymous donor gave $5,000.

Richard Harvey of Wiscasset prepares the area around the Library Park Memorial before Memorial Day ceremonies on Monday, May 25, in Bath. Harvey, who is not a military veteran, said he does the work to keep the memories of fallen service members alive.Shane McKenna, left, and Dan Eosco discuss Memorial Day parade details in Bath on Monday morning. They stepped in to help manage the event after an anonymous donor picked up most of the tab.
